内容主体大纲 1. 引言 - 介绍TRX钱包及其重要性 - TRON生态系统概况2. 什么是TRX钱包? - TRX钱包的定义 - TRX钱包的类型...
USDT(Tether)是一种针对区块链的稳定币,其价值紧密挂钩于法定货币(如美元)。稳定币的设计目的在于提供一个稳定的加密货币替代品,使用户在加密市场波动中也能保持价值稳定。USDT广泛应用于各大交易所和区块链项目中。
断链钱包是指在不连接区块链网络的情况下,依旧能够操作和管理数字资产的钱包。这种钱包的核心特性在于其离线存储能力,能够减少网络攻击的风险。
源代码是实现特定功能的程序代码,了解和掌握相关的源代码对于开发者至关重要。通过深入分析源代码,开发者不仅能实现预期功能,还能规避潜在的安全风险。
#### USDT与区块链技术USDT是基于区块链技术构建的,通过智能合约和发行机制来维持其与法定货币的1:1比例。USDT的架构分为发行、交易和赎回三个主要阶段,每个阶段都有其独特的功能和技术。
与比特币、以太坊等其他数字货币不同,USDT的价值是与现实中的货币挂钩的,因此它相对稳定。用户可以快速进行交易而不必担心价格的大幅波动。
#### 断链钱包的工作原理断链钱包的工作原理在于离线存储和管理私钥。即使网络连接被完全断开,用户依然可以在本地环境中生成交易签名,并在需要时将这些交易数据上传至网络。
热钱包是一直在线的钱包,随时可以进行交易,但其安全性相对较低。与之相比,断链钱包是离线的,因此其安全性较高,但操作相对不便,通常适合用于长期存储。
#### 断链钱包的实现技术在开发断链钱包时,常用的编程语言包括Python、JavaScript、C 等。选择适合的框架,如Node.js或Django,也是非常重要的,因为它们可以简化开发过程并提供更多功能。
断链钱包的设计必须考虑到用户的私钥安全。实现硬件安全模块(HSM)和多重签名机制可以进一步增强钱包的安全性。
的用户界面有助于提高用户的使用体验。设计时应考虑到用户的流线型操作,提供直观的功能入口。
#### 源代码解析USDT断链钱包的核心功能模块包括钱包生成、转账、查询余额和历史交易记录等。每个功能模块都需要进行详细的设计和实现。
例如,生成钱包的代码示范: ```python import secrets def generate_wallet(): private_key = secrets.token_hex(32) return private_key ``` 本文将详细分析代码的每一部分及其背后的逻辑。
编写代码过程中可能会发生许多常见错误,如逻辑错误、空指针引用和安全漏洞。应及时进行代码审计和测试,以确保系统的可靠性。
#### USDT断链钱包的运行与维护部署断链钱包通常涉及到配置服务器环境、数据库设置和代码部署等步骤。通过Docker等容器技术可以简化部署过程。
对于任何钱包而言,数据备份是至关重要的。定期备份用户的私钥和其他敏感信息,以避免因数据丢失造成资产损失。
随着技术的发展,定期更新和钱包功能显得尤为重要。通过对用户反馈的收集和数据分析,能够持续提升产品的用户体验。
#### 未来展望随着区块链技术的不断演进,断链钱包的安全性与便捷性将达到一个新的高度。用户对于隐私和安全的关注将促使钱包采用更多的新技术。
未来,USDT及其他稳定币在金融市场的应用将会更加广泛。尤其在跨境支付、电子商务等领域,他们将扮演越来越重要的角色。
#### 结论开发者在构建USDT断链钱包时,应重视代码的安全性和高效性,通过社区的力量与众多开发者协作,提升产品的质量与安全性。
断链钱包在数字资产管理中的重要性不言而喻,合理的设计和实现将为用户提供更好的体验,也将促进整个区块链生态的健康发展。
### 相关问题及详细讨论 1. **USDT的技术背景是什么?** 2. **断链钱包的安全性如何保障?** 3. **开发断链钱包需要哪些技能和知识?** 4. **如何推广和获得用户对断链钱包的信任?** 5. **区块链技术如何在断链钱包中应用?** 6. **断链钱包和热钱包的使用场景是什么?** ### 针对每个问题的详细介绍 #### USDT的技术背景是什么? (介绍内容...) #### 断链钱包的安全性如何保障? (介绍内容...) #### 开发断链钱包需要哪些技能和知识? (介绍内容...) #### 如何推广和获得用户对断链钱包的信任? (介绍内容...) #### 区块链技术如何在断链钱包中应用? (介绍内容...) #### 断链钱包和热钱包的使用场景是什么? (介绍内容...) 以上是根据请求整理的内容框架及初步回答思路。具体详细内容可以根据每个部分进行扩展和深入分析,最终形成3700字以上的完整文章。